
China’s impressive engineering prowess can be attributed to a combination of strategic leadership, education reform, and investment in research and development. The country’s transformation into an engineering powerhouse began in the late 1970s when Deng Xiaoping, then China’s leader, visited Japan and was fascinated by the country’s high-speed trains, roads, and rapid industrialization.
Deng recognized that the key to Japan’s success lay in its strong foundation in engineering and mathematics education. He implemented significant changes in China’s education system, including:
- Emphasis on STEM Education: Deng shifted the focus from history, political science, and ideology to mathematics, physics, and engineering.
- Teacher Training: He invested in training secondary teachers to educate students in mathematics.
- Scholarships: Deng introduced the PRC Scholarship, which sent students to study engineering and teaching in the USA, UK, Canada, and Japan.
Subsequent leaders, including Jiang Zemin and Xi Jinping, built upon Deng’s foundation. Jiang introduced mining and metallurgy as engineering disciplines and brought in professional engineers as project consultants. Xi focused on fine engineering and micro-engineering, aiming to increase the workforce in this area to 1 million by 2035.
China’s investment in research and development has also been crucial to its engineering success. The country began its first state research fund in 1987 with $3 million, which has since grown to $366 billion annually.
